Hello Son,

Here we are once again at the start of yet another amazing week. I hope that you had a great weekend and that you thoroughly enjoyed doing something fun and interesting.

Yeah, I know that I sometimes sound like a broken record when I speak about the amazing week to come. If you stop and think about it, isn’t it better to approach your week with energy and enthusiasm? We could just as easily dread the heck out of the upcoming Monday and the week that lies ahead. Many people do exactly that. Do you know what happens to people with that mindset? That lousy Monday and week of dullness and drudgery that they anticipated actually becomes a happens the way they had played it out in their minds. In other words, it became a self-fulfilling prophecy!

So what happens when you anticipate an amazing week? That can become a self-fulfilling prophecy as well. As Louis Pasteur said, “Chance favors the prepared mind.” By anticipating and planning for an amazing week, you automatically increase your chances of having an amazing week.
